The following buttons are presented at the top:
Select All: Select all devices in the list.
Deselect All: Deselect all devices in the list.
Expand All: to view the resources of all devices in the list.
Collapse All: to hide the resources of all devices in the list.
N.B.: Sub-sampling function
The Sub-sampling function can be summarized as follows: the system examines the extent of the interval to
be analyzed, divides it into n sub-intervals (where n is the number of records set in section F) and displays 1
record for each of the sub-intervals.
Only analogue resources are shown.
Even if selected using other filters, any other resources are not shown.
Select devices (and associated resources as applicable) to capture data from using the check boxes to the left of the name, then

The first column identifies the date/time the data was saved, then the next few columns list the previously selected resources with
the values recorded for each device.
The
icon allows you to expand variations of asynchronous resources (statuses and digital inputs).
The
icon allows you to collapse variations of asynchronous resources (statuses and digital inputs).
Four lines with a colored background may also be shown:
RED background: establishes the time during which data logging was stopped (Logging stopped).
GREEN background: establishes the time during which data logging took place (Logging in progress).
YELLOW background: establishes when the time was changed (Time change).
GREY background: establishes the timescale of a power off period or a power supply failure (Plant blackout).
